Promotion of Prof. Ralph Ossa

As of 1 July 2025, Prof. Ralph Ossa will assume the UBS Foundation Professorship of Economics at the Department of Economics, following his service (2023–2025) as Chief Economist of the World Trade Organization (WTO).
Prof. Ossa is a leading expert in international trade, economic geography and global value chains. His research combines quantitative rigor with real-world policy relevance and has been published in top-tier economics journals. He is also the recipient of a prestigious ERC Consolidator Grant.
At the WTO, Prof. Ossa provided high-level economic guidance on key global trade issues such as protectionism, climate policy and digital globalization. The Faculty is pleased to welcome him back in this expanded role.
